Property Details for 23 Hero St, Eatons Hill

23 Hero St, Eatons Hill is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1995. The property has a land size of 750m2 and floor size of 175m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2024.

About Eatons Hill 4037

The size of Eatons Hill is approximately 8.9 square kilometres. It has 25 parks covering nearly 14.1% of total area. The population of Eatons Hill in 2016 was 7973 people. By 2021 the population was 7822 showing a population decline of 1.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Eatons Hill is 10-19 years. Households in Eatons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Eatons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 88.60% of the homes in Eatons Hill were owner-occupied compared with 86.00% in 2016.

Eatons Hill has 2,635 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Eatons Hill have seen a 91.61%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 5.32%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Eatons Hill is $1,285,285 while the median value for Units is $892,208.
  • Houses have a median rent of $815.
There are currently 4 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Eatons hill on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 114 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Eatons hill.
